Partisan Divide: Michigan, Texas Take Differing Approaches To Reopening
Wed, 06 May 2020
As new confirmed cases decline in the state, Michigan has extended its stay-at-home order until May 15th. Texas is moving quickly toward reopening, and while the state's outbreak is comparatively less severe, it isn't tapering off.
